think about it, how much would a giant billboard cost in time square? Now think of a billboard with over 500 million viewers, that view this billboard several times a day.... now think if you knew pretty much everything about these viewers, they're interests, they're age etc.... all of a sudden you have a billboard/adspace (much like television) that not only allows you to perfectly segment your target market, but also provides links to additional information and allows potential customers to purchase or review a product from the comfort of their computer chair....

 

When you have an adspace that is this huge, specific and interactive, you have yourself a goldmine....

if you fill it out, they know

 

your age

your location

your hobbies

your sexual preference/religion/political leanings

what bands you like

what shows you watch

what movies you watch

what books you read

same info for your friends

 

even without giving your name & specific details or even showing you ads, they can cross reference all that data, take it to an ad agency and say "hey, there's now a trend with gay White christian republican males aged 18-27 to listen to Ben harper, snowboard and eat tacos, pay us", then suddenly taco bell has ads on tv with a chalupa snowboarding while Ground on Down plays in the background.

 

money is in the data, not anything you actually see on the site. games and little ads are just bonus money.
